I use these light weight indoor car covers made of a stretchable cotton lycra material and when removed they are a small little bundle of balled up fabric. Easily washed in gentle machine load (front load type) or hand washed and hung to dry. I used to have those thick grey covers with the fleece but they were so big all I could do was take them to the dry cleaners to wash at $50 a pop. Needless to say those are no longer used around here.
